Los Nogales - Typica Virtuoso is a specialty coffee from Finca Los Nogales in Pitalito, Huila, Colombia, produced by Oscar Hernandez. The coffee is made from Castillo and Typica varieties, grown at 1870–2000 meters above sea level. It undergoes an advanced proprietary processing method using a specific yeast strain for fermentation combined with thermal shock processing and oxidation, creating a unique fermentation profile. The coffee offers tasting notes of cherry cordial, fruit cocktail, white sangria, and ganache, with vibrant acidity and a sweet, chocolate-forward finish.

Black & White is a Raleigh, North Carolina roaster with a refreshingly simple creed: 'If it tastes good, it is good.' They hunt down the most interesting coffees they can find and organise them in a genuinely helpful way — by roast level and even by a 'funk' scale from clean to wild — so you know what you're getting into. New coffees drop weekly, from washed everyday lots to experimental naturals and their high-end Black Label competition coffees. There's a subscription if you'd rather explore on autopilot, plus US shipping and wholesale. A brilliant pick for adventurous drinkers who like variety and a bit of funk.
